Cycle stocks represent companies involved in the production, sale, and distribution of bicycles and related components for personal, recreational, and commercial use.
Bicycle manufacturers – Companies producing standard, electric, and speciality bicycles.
Bicycle component suppliers – Firms making parts like gears, brakes, tyres, and frames.
Electric bicycle producers – Companies focused on e-bikes for urban mobility and recreation.
Cycle retailers & distributors – Businesses handling the sale and distribution of bicycles and cycling accessories.
Cycling gear & accessories makers – Companies producing helmets, apparel, and other cycling equipment.
Cycle stocks benefit from growing interest in eco-friendly transportation, health-conscious lifestyles, and urban mobility solutions, particularly with rising e-bike demand.
Risks include seasonal demand fluctuations, competition from other modes of transport, economic downturns impacting discretionary spending, and dependency on raw material costs.
Key factors include consumer demand, government policies promoting eco-friendly transportation, fuel prices, disposable income levels, and the growth of cycling infrastructure. These factors play a pivotal role in shaping the cycle stocks in India.
During economic expansions, bicycle stocks tend to see higher demand due to increased consumer spending and recreational activity, leading to higher valuations. Conversely, during downturns, demand may fall, affecting stock performance. This behaviour makes them part of the cyclical stock category.
Cyclical stocks, such as bicycle stocks, can provide diversification by offering potential growth during economic upturns while acting as a hedge when other sectors underperform during recessions.
Fluctuations in the cost of raw materials like steel, aluminium, and rubber can significantly affect cycle companies' profit margins, as these materials are essential to manufacturing bicycles.
Cycle manufacturers in India may benefit from tax incentives such as lower GST rates, exemptions or reductions in import duties on raw materials, and tax breaks for producing eco-friendly or electric bicycles. The best cyclical stocks often find ways to capitalise on these incentives.
